:root{--text:#6b6375;--text-h:#08060d;--bg:#fff;--border:#e5e4e7;--code-bg:#f4f3ec;--accent:#aa3bff;--accent-bg:#aa3bff1a;--accent-border:#aa3bff80;--social-bg:#f4f3ec80;--shadow:#0000001a 0 .26667rem .4rem -.08rem, #0000000d 0 .10667rem .16rem -.05333rem;--sans:system-ui, "Segoe UI", Roboto, sans-serif;--heading:system-ui, "Segoe UI", Roboto, sans-serif;--mono:ui-monospace, Consolas, monospace;font:.48rem/145% var(--sans);letter-spacing:.18px;--lightningcss-light:initial;--lightningcss-dark: ;color-scheme:light dark;color:var(--text);background:var(--bg);font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}@media (prefers-color-scheme:dark){:root{--lightningcss-light: ;--lightningcss-dark:initial;--text:#9ca3af;--text-h:#f3f4f6;--bg:#16171d;--border:#2e303a;--code-bg:#1f2028;--accent:#c084fc;--accent-bg:#c084fc26;--accent-border:#c084fc80;--social-bg:#2f303a80;--shadow:#0006 0 .26667rem .4rem -.08rem, #00000040 0 .10667rem .16rem -.05333rem}#social .button-icon{filter:invert()brightness(2)}}body{margin:0}#root{width:100%;max-width:var(--max-layout-width);text-align:left;box-sizing:border-box;flex-direction:column;min-height:100svh;margin:0 auto;display:flex}h1,h2{font-family:var(--heading);color:var(--text-h);font-weight:500}h1{letter-spacing:-1.68px;margin:.85333rem 0;font-size:1.49333rem}h2{letter-spacing:-.24px;margin:0 0 .21333rem;font-size:.64rem;line-height:118%}p{margin:0}code,.counter{font-family:var(--mono);color:var(--text-h);border-radius:.10667rem;display:inline-flex}code{background:var(--code-bg);padding:.10667rem .21333rem;font-size:.4rem;line-height:135%}.profile-page{width:100%;max-width:var(--max-layout-width);color:#222;text-align:left;background-color:#f5f3f0;min-height:62.1333rem;margin:0 auto;position:relative;overflow:hidden}.profile-page p,.profile-page h1,.profile-page h2{margin:0;font-weight:400;line-height:normal;position:absolute}.hero-diamond{color:#6e3b3b;text-align:center;width:.45333rem;height:.58667rem;font-family:Georgia,Times New Roman,serif;font-size:.48rem;top:.74667rem;left:1.02667rem;transform:translate(-50%)}.hero-title{color:#222;width:7.33333rem;height:1.46667rem;font-family:PingFang SC,Microsoft YaHei,sans-serif;font-size:.96rem;top:1.73333rem;left:.8rem}.hero-subtitle{color:#6e3b3b;width:6.18667rem;height:.45333rem;font-family:PingFang SC,Microsoft YaHei,sans-serif;font-size:.29333rem;top:3.44rem;left:.8rem}.hero-avatar-wrap{border:1px solid #6e3b3b;border-radius:50%;justify-content:center;align-items:center;width:3.46667rem;height:3.46667rem;line-height:0;display:flex;position:absolute;top:4.98667rem;left:5.76rem}.hero-avatar{object-fit:cover;border-radius:50%;width:3.2rem;height:3.2rem;display:block}.intro-text{color:#222;font-family:Noto Serif SC,Noto Serif,serif;font-size:.26667rem;line-height:normal;position:absolute;top:9.52rem;left:.8rem}.intro-text p{height:.4rem;margin:0 0 .10667rem;position:relative;top:auto;left:auto}.intro-text p:last-child{margin-bottom:0}.divider{border-top:.6px solid #6e3b3b;width:8.34667rem;height:0;position:absolute;left:.8rem}.divider-icon{color:#6e3b3b;background-color:#f5f3f0;padding:0 .10667rem;font-family:Inter,system-ui,sans-serif;font-size:.32rem;line-height:1;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.divider-1{top:14.4533rem}.divider-2{top:26.6667rem}.divider-3{top:37.12rem}.divider-4{top:47.6rem}.divider-5{top:58.0533rem}.section-num{color:#6e3b3b;font-family:PingFang SC,Microsoft YaHei,sans-serif;font-size:.48rem;left:.8rem}.section-num-1{width:.56rem;height:.74667rem;top:15.7867rem}.section-num-2{width:.64rem;height:.72rem;top:27.7067rem}.section-num-3{width:.64rem;height:.74667rem;top:38.16rem}.section-title{color:#222;font-family:PingFang SC,Microsoft YaHei,sans-serif;left:.8rem}.section-title-1{width:5.33333rem;height:.93333rem;font-size:.61333rem;top:16.9333rem}.section-title-2{width:1.33333rem;height:.93333rem;font-size:.61333rem;top:28.8533rem}.section-title-3{width:1.33333rem;height:.93333rem;font-size:.61333rem;top:39.3067rem}.section-title-contact{width:2.08rem;height:.98667rem;font-size:.64rem;top:48.9867rem}.section-body{color:#222;font-family:PingFang SC,Microsoft YaHei,sans-serif;font-size:.26667rem;line-height:normal;position:absolute;left:.8rem}.section-body p{height:.4rem;margin:0 0 .13333rem;position:relative;top:auto;left:auto}.section-body p:last-child{margin-bottom:0}.section-body-1{width:6.10667rem;top:18.3467rem}.section-body-2{width:3.76rem;font-family:Noto Serif SC,Noto Serif,serif;top:30.2667rem}.section-body-3{width:5.78667rem;font-family:Noto Serif SC,Noto Serif,serif;top:40.72rem}.section-body-contact{width:4.93333rem;font-family:Noto Serif SC,Noto Serif,serif;top:50.56rem}.qr-img{object-fit:cover;width:2.13333rem;height:2.13333rem;position:absolute}.qr-red-note{top:23.4667rem;left:4.4rem}.qr-gong-zhong-hao{top:23.4667rem;left:7.01333rem}.qr-wang-yi-yun{top:33.92rem;left:7.01333rem}.qr-shou-shi{top:44.4rem;left:7.01333rem}.qr-lian-xi-wo{top:54.8533rem;left:7.01333rem}.qr-label{color:#222;width:.88rem;height:.4rem;font-family:Noto Serif SC,Noto Serif,serif;font-size:.26667rem}.qr-label-red-note{top:25.68rem;left:5.04rem}.qr-label-gong-zhong-hao{top:25.68rem;left:7.65333rem}.footer-text{color:#6e3b3b;text-align:center;width:2.77333rem;height:.45333rem;font-family:Noto Serif SC,Noto Serif,serif;font-size:.32rem;top:60.0267rem;left:50%;transform:translate(-50%)}
